Cornwall Council Christmas Tree Recycling

Nov 29, 2021 | News

After Christmas, Cornwall Council will collect non-artificial Christmas trees up to 6ft tall. Residents should cut their tree in two if larger than 6ft. The trees will be shredded and composted.

People with subscriptions to Cornwall Council’s garden waste service should put their real Christmas tree out on their normal garden waste collection day. People who don’t have a garden waste subscription should put their tree out on their rubbish collection day between Monday 10 January and Friday 14 January 2022

People can also take their real Christmas trees to their nearest Household Waste and Recycling Centre. Decorations and pots should be removed before trees are recycled.
